Prima lectie Lesson 1

Gramatica Grammar.

Mai intai, iti dezvalui un secret: limba Engleza

are o gramatica mai simpla decat limba

Romana. Prin urmare, mai usor de invatat.

Forma de plural a substantivelor este obtinuta in

general prin adaugarea terminatiei ”s”.

Apple- apples - mar-mere

Cat- cats- pisica-pisici

Dog- dogs- caine- caini

Bat-bats- liliac-lilieci

Horse-horses- cal-cai

Leg-legs- picior-picioare

Window-windows- fereastra-ferestre

Mirror-mirrors- oglinda-oglinzi

Door-doors- usa-usi

Exceptie fac substantivele cu forma de plural

neregulata.

Man-men- varbat-barbati

Woman-women- femeie-femei

Foot-feet- talpa-talpi

Ox-oxen- bou-boi

Mouse-mice- soarece-soareci

Goose-geese- gasca-gaste

Sheep-sheep- oaie-oi

Child-children- copil-copii

In limba Engleza nu exista pronume de

politete,“you”fiind folosit universal- atat pentru

a exprima pronumele “tu”, cat si

“dumneavoastra”. Ceea ce face diferenta este

maniera de adresare.

Verbele limbi Engleze se conjuga mult mai

simplu decat in limba noastra, la prezentul

simplu, “Present Tense” exista de obicei o

singura terminatie diferita, aceea pentru

persoana a 3-a singular.

La trecutul simplu, ”Past Tense” al verbelor

regulate terminatia este acceasi pentru toate

persoanele -“ed”.

Adjectivele nu au forme diferite la feminin sau

masculin, la singular sau plural. Spre exemplu,

adjectivul “smart- istet”:

She is a smart girl.

He is a smart kid.

They are smart people.

Este o fetita isteata.

Este un pusti istet.

Sunt oameni isteti.

Trei verbe sunt foarte importante in constructia

oricarei propozitii sau fraze in limba Engleza, to

be, to have, to do, adica: a fi, a avea si a face.

Fiecare dintre ele poate indeplini si functia de

verb auxiliar.

Lectia a 2-a. Lesson 2

Gramatica. Grammar

Personal Pronoun. Pronumele personal

Page 8: Suport curs tiparit

8

Pronumele personal inlocuieste substantivul si

are doua forme- el este fie subiectul, fie obiectul

actiunii.

The Personal Pronoun replaces the noun and it

has two forms. It is either the subject or the

object of the action.

Examples:

Exemple:

I am Mini. It’s about me.

Eu sunt Mini. Este vorba despre mine.

You are Paul. It’s about you.

Tu esti Paul este vorba despre tine.

She is Alice. It’s about her.

Ea este Alice. Este vorba despre ea.

He is Andrew. It’s about him.

El este Andrei. Este vorba despre el.

It’s the cat. It’s about it.

Este pisica. Este vorba despre ea.

We are a family. It’s about us.

Noi suntem o familie. Este vorba despre noi.

You are brothers. It’s about you.

Voi sunteti frati. Este vorba despre voi.

They are friends. It’s about them.

Ei sunt prieteni. Este vorba despre ei.

Pronumele “it” poate inlocui lucruri, obiecte sau

fiinte despre care nu avem informatii legate de

gen sau sex. Poate fi vorba despre o carte, un

caine, sau chiar despre un bebelus.

Exista insa si exceptii de la aceasta regula, acele

obiecte care au gen.

Spre exemplu: ship- vas, ambarcatiune, are

genul feminin.

The ship is here. She is here.

Vasul este aici. Este aici

La fel se intampla si in cazul unor tari precum

Franta sau Marea Britanie.

Tot acum vom invata cum anume putem adresa

o intrebare in limba Engleza:

When- cand

Where -unde

What- ce

Which - care

Who- cine

How -cum

Trebuie sa mai stim si faptul ca forma

interogativa rastoarna constructia enuntului

format din subiect si predicat. Astfel, “I am”

devine “Am I ”, “I have” devine “have I” si tot

asa.

Lectia a 3-a Lesson Grammar

Articolul. The article

Articolul insoteste substantivul si arata cat de

cunoscut ne este acesta. El arata diferenta intre

”a tiger” – un tigru orecare si “the tiger”-tigrul,

cu identitate precisa.

The article is attached to the noun and it shows

how familiar this is to us.

Articolul este astasat de substantiv si arata cat

de familiar ne este acesta.

Referire generala. Generic reference

Tigers are dangerous animals.

Tigrii sunt animale periculoase.

Russians are exceptional artists.

Rusii sunt artisti exceptionali.

French people have excellent cuisine.

Francezii au o bucatarie excelenta.

Music is delightful.

Muzica este incantatoare.

Articolul hotarat. Definite Article

The Russian is a good dancer.

Rusul este un bun dansator.

The lion is the king of all animals.

Leul este regele tuturor animalelor.

The lady is beautiful.

Doamna este frumoasa.

Articolul nehotarat. Indefinite Article

A friend in need is a friend indeed.

Prietenul la nevoie se cunoaste.

A woman stands in front of the door.

O femei sta in fata usii.

De retinut ca in limba Engleza articolul

nehotarat “a” devine “an” atunci cand este plasat

inaintea substantivelor care incep cu vocala sau

semivocala:

An elephant- un elefant

An egg- un ou

An apple- un mar

An orange- o portocala

Articolul hotarat “the”, se citeste diferit in

functie de substantivul pe care il precede.

Daca substantivul incepe cu consoana, articolul

hotarat se citeste...

The tiger

The dress

The Russian

The lion

The lady

Daca substantivul incepe cu vocala, articolul

hotarat se citeste...

The elephant

The end

The apple

The orange

The egg

The Present Tense. Timpul prezent

La conjugarile prezentului, verbele isi schimba

forma de infinitiv doar la persoana a treia

singular, unde primesc un “s” final.

I remember.

Eu imi aminesc.

You remember.

Tu iti amintesti.

She remembers.

Ea isi aminteste.

He remembers.

El isi aminteste.

We remember.

Noi ne amintim.

You remember.

Voi va amintiti.

They remember.

Ei isi amintesc.

I spend

Eu petrec.

You spend.

Tu petreci.

She spends.

Ea petrece.

He spends.

El petrece.

We spend.

Noi petrecem.

You spend.

Voi petreceti.

They spend.

Ei petrec.

Exceptie fac verbele a caror pronuntie necesita

mici modificari.

Este si cazul verbelor:

“to do”: He or she does –el sau ea face;

“to go”: She or he goes- Ea sau el merge;

“to have”: She or he has- Ea sau el are;

“to fly”: She or he flies- Ea sau el zboara;

“to dry”: She or he dries- Ea sau el se usuca;

“to cry”: She or he cries- El sau ea plange.

Excetie face si verbul “to be” care are un

comportament aparte la conjugarea prezentului:

I am

You are

She is

He is

We are

You are

They are

Pentru a obtine forma de plural, substantivele

primesc si ele in majoritatea cazurilor un “s”

final:

Boy/boys- baiat/baieti

Car/cars- masina/masini

Girl/girls- fata/fete

Cat/cats- pisica/pisici

Dog/dogs- caine/caini

Apple/apples- mar/mere

Horse/horses- cal/cai

Leg/legs- picior/picioare

Window/windows- fereastra/ferestre

Mirror/mirrors- oglinda/oglinzi

Door/doors- usa/usi

Exceptie fac substantivele a caror terminatie nu

permite o pronuntie fireasca prin adaugarea unui

simplu “s”:

Dress/dresses-rochie/rochii

Glass/glasses-pahar/pahare

Sau

Knife/knives- cutit/cutite

Wife/wives-sotie/sotii

Tot exceptie reprezinta si substantivele cu forma

de plural neregulata:

Man/men- barbat/barbati

Woman/women- femeie/femei

Foot/feet- talpa/talpi

Ox/oxen- bou/boi

Mouse/mice- soarece/soareci

Goose/geese- gasca/gaste

Sheep/sheep- oaie/oi

Child/children- copil/copii

Lectia a sasea. Lesson 6 Grammar. Gramatica

Present Continous Tense. Prezentul

Continuu

Prezentul continuu este alcatuit din prezentul

verbului “To be” si forma in “ing” a verbului

care este conjugat. Forma continua a prezentului

arata o actiune care are loc in clipa de fata.

To be + to eat + ing

I am eating.

Eu mananc.

You are eating.

Tu mananci.

She is eating.

Ea mananca.

He is eating.

El mananca.

We are eating.

Noi mancam.

You are eating.

Voi mancati.

They are eating.

Ei mananca.

To be + to read + ing

I am reading.

Eu citesc.

You are reading.

Tu citesti.

She is reading.

Ea citeste.

He is reading.

El citeste.

We are reading.

Noi citim.

You are reading.

Voi cititi.

They are reading.

Ei citesc.

Prezentul continuu face distinctia intre timpul

prezent in general si momentul de fata. Astfel:

I go to school every day.

Ma duc la scoala in fiecare zi.

I am going to school right now.

Ma duc la scoala chiar acum.

I do my homework every evening.

Imi fac tema in fiecare seara.

I’m doing my homework now.

Imi fac tema acum.

Iata si forma negativa:

I’m not reading the newspaper right now.

Nu citesc ziarul chiar acum.

I am not listening to music now.

Nu ascult muzica acum.

Lectia a 7-a. Lesson 7

Grammar. Gramatica

The Genitive Case. Genitivul

Genitivul este cazul atributului si exprima in

primul rand posesiunea sau apartenenta si

raspunde la intrebarile “whose”-al, a, ai, ale cui;

“what” sau “which”- care.

We say.

Spunem:

Allen’s wife is an actress.

Sotia lui Allen este actrita.

The cat’s kittens are nice.

Puii pisicii sunt draguti.

Page 29: Suport curs tiparit

29

Maggie’s house is on the corner.

Casa lui Maggie este pe colt.

We are happy about my father’s arrival.

Suntem fericiti de sosirea tatalui meu.

It is good to have somebody’s admiration.

Este bine sa te bucuri de admiratia cuiva.

I am reading Shakespeare’s Romeo and Juliet.

Citesc Romeo si Julieta lui Shakespeare.

Paul’s ideas are good.

Ideile lui Paul sunt bune.

Nick’s parents are both doctors.

Parintii lui Nick sunt amandoi doctori.

But we say:

Dar spunem:

The key of my door is on the table.

Cheia de la usa mea este pe masa.

Sometimes the passage of time is slow.

Uneori trecerea timpului este inceata.

I have a feeling of joy.

Am un sentiment de bucurie.

The roof of the house is damaged.

Acoperisul casei este stricat.

I want a slice of cake.

Vreau o felie de tort.

The month of June is really beautiful in my

country.

Luna iunie este cu adevarat frumoasa in tara

mea.

The cover of the book is dark blue.

Coperta cartii este albastru inchis.

Observatii.

Substantivele care se termina in “s” sau “ss”

primesc doar apostroful.

Dickens’ novels are in my bookcase.

Romanele lui Dickens sunt in bibleoteca mea.

The adjective. Adjectivul

Much and many.

Much este folosit cu substantivele nenumarabile

si exprima cantitatea.

Teaching English gives much pleasure to me.

Predarea limbii Engleze imi ofera multa placere

There is much sand on you shoes.

Este mult nisip pe pantofii tai.

I need much sugar into my coffee.

Am nevoie de mult zahar in cafeaua mea.

She gives him much love.

Ii ofera multa dragoste.

There isn’t much room left in their kitchen.

Nu prea le ramane spatiu in bucatarie.

I need much time to think about it.

Am nevoie de mult timp ca sa ma gandesc la

asta.

Many este folosit cu substantive numarabile si

exprima numarul:

There are many roses in my garden.

Sunt multi trandafiri in gradina.

We have many new ideas.

Avem multe idei noi.

Mary has many friends.

Mary are multi prieteni.

There are many chairs in their kitchen.

Sunt multe scaune in bucataria lor.

There are many students in the library.

Sunt multi studenti la bibleoteca.

They have too many pictures on their walls.

Au prea multe tablouri pe pereti.

Lectia a 13-a. Lesson 13. Grammar. Gramatica.

Comparison of short adjectives. Comparatia

adjectivelor scurte.

Adjectivele monosilabice, bisilabive, si cele

trei-silabice cu prefix negativ au forma

flexionara la comparativ si superlativ prin

alipirea sufixelor “er” si “est”.

De egalitate:

As calm as- la fel de calm ca

As large as- la fel de larg ca

As old as- la fel de in varsta ca

As kind as- la fel de amabil ca

As friendly as- la fel de prietenos ca

As unlucky as- la fel de ghinionist ca

De superioritate

Calmer than- mai calm decat

Larger than- mai larg decat

Older than- mai in varsta decat

Kinder than- mai amabil decat

Friendlier than- mai prietenos decat

Unluckier than- mai ghinionist decat

La superlativ

The calmest- cel mai calm

The largest- cel mai larg

The oldest- cel mai in varsta

The kindest- cel mai amabil

The friendliest- cel mai prietenos

The unluckiest- cel mai ghinionist

Mike is as old as my son.

Mike este de aceeasi varsta cu fiul meu.

He is the friendliest boy in town.

El este cel mai prietenos baiat din oras.

It is the largest district of Paris.

Este cel mai mare cartier al Parisului.

I’m older than you.

Eu sunt mai in varsta decat tine.

Comparison of Long Adjectives. Comparatia

adjectivelor lungi

Adjectivele mai lungi de doua silabe, cele bi-

silabice la care accentul cade pe prima silaba

formeaza comparativul si superlativul cu

ajutorul adverbelor “more” si “most”.

De exemplu, de egalitate:

As curious as- la fel de curios ca

As beautiful as- la fel de frumos ca

As important as- la fel de important ca

As attractive as- la fel de atragator ca

As fragile as- la fel de fragil ca

De superioritate:

More curious than- mai curios decat

More beautiful than- mai frumos decat

More important than- mai important decat

More attractive than- mai atragator decat

More fragile than- mai fragil decat

Superlativ:

The most curious- cel mai curios

The most beautiful- cel mai frumos

The most important- cel mai important

The most attractive- cel mai atragator

The most fragile- cel mai fragil

She is as beautiful as always.

Ea este la fel de frumoasa ca intotdeauna.

It is more important than the other exam.

Este mai important decat celalalt examen.

It is the most attractive landscape.

Este cel mai atractiv peisaj.

Adjectives with Irregular Forms. Adjective

cu forme neregulate

Good/ well = bun - better than= mai bun decat-

the best= cel mai bun

Page 44: Suport curs tiparit

44

Bad or ill= rau- worse than= mai rau decat- the

worst= cel mai rau

Little- putin- less than= mai putin decat- the

least= cel mai putin

Much or many- mult- more than= mai mult

decat- the most= cel mai mult

Lectia a 9-a. Lesson 9

Grammar. Gramatica

The Past Tense. Trecutul Simplu

In limba Engleza, trecutul simplu are o singura

forma pentru toate pesoanele, cu exceptia

verbului “to be”. Trecutul simplu al verbelor

regulate se formeaza prin adaugarea sufixului

“ed” la forma de infinitiv a verbului care este

conjugat.

Regular verbs:

I remembered

Eu mi-am amintit

You remembered

Tu ti-ai amintit

She remembered

Ea si-a amintit

He remembered

El si-a amintit

We remembered

Noi ne-am amintit

You remembered

Voi v-ati amintit

They remembered

Ei si-au amintit

I danced

Eu am dansat

You danced

Tu ai dansat

She danced

Ea a dansat

He danced

El a dansat

We danced

Noi am dansat

You danced

Voi ati dansat

They danced

Ei au dansat

Page 75: Suport curs tiparit

75

In functie de context, in limba Romana, The

Past Tense este fie echivalentul Perfectului

Compus fie al imperfectului.

Verbul “to be”, care este neregulat, are doua

forme la trecut: “was” si “were”.

I was a teacher.

Eu am fost profesor.

You were tired.

Tu erai obosit.

She was happy.

Ea era fericita.

He was in Paris last week.

El era la Paris saptamana trecuta.

We were friends.

Am fost prieteni.

You were my students.

Ati fost elevii mei.

They were busy.

Ei erau ocupati.

Celelalte verbe neregulate, au la trecut aceeasi

forma pentru toate persoanele, forma care

trebuie memorata, ca atare.

Ce ai tu de facut? Ai de invatat la fiecare lectie

cate 10 verbe neregulate, impreuna cu toate

formele lor de infinitiv, trecut, si participiu

trecut.

You have to learn them by heart.

Trebuie sa le inveti pe de rost.

10 irregular verbs. 10 verbe neregulate

A fi = to be- was/were- been

A deveni = to become- became- become

A incepe = to begin- began-begun

A sparge, a rupe= to break- broke- broken

A aduce= to bring- brought- brought

A construi= to build- built-built

A cumpara= to buy- bought- bought

A prinde= to catch- caught-caught

A alege= to choose-chose-chosen

A veni= to come- came- come

Verbul “to have” este de asemenea neregulat si

are la trecut forma “had”.

She had a nightmare.

Ea a avut un cosmar.

We had many things to do when we came back

home.

Noi am avut multe lucruri de facut cand ne-am

intors acasa.

Auxiliarul “to do” are si el o singura forma la

Past Tense- “did”.

I did all that I had to do.

Am facut tot ceea ce a trebuit sa fac.

We did our best to save him.

Am facut tot ce ne-a stat in puteri sa-l salvam.

La trecut, forma negativa se obtine la fel ca la

prezent:

I didn’t disturb her.

Eu nu am deranjat-o.

She didn’t remember the question.

Ea nu si-a amintit intrebarea.

They didn’t dance at the party.

Ei nu au dansat la petrecere.

We didn’t buy the flat.

Noi nu am cumparat apartamentul.
